Development of TIO₂ nanotube and SNO₂ nanofiber supported gold nanoparticle based non-enzymatic H₂O₂ sensors and its practical applications
Electrochemical sensors, a state-of-the-art technological tool at the time, provide realtime monitoring capabilities, allowing convenient and rapid analysis of specific compounds in various domains.
